We would like to inform you that you mentioned overstaying the residence and that you want to leave to go to India, then according to the UAE Residence of Foreigners any foreigner whose visa or residence permit has been canceled or whose residency has expired upon the expiry of the period of the permit, visa or residence permit, and the renewal is not initiated within 30 days from the date of completion or has not left, the state, then a fine which not exceeding (100) AED shall, during this period, be imposed for every day of illegal residence in the State starting from the end date of the grace period. If the fine is not paid, the violator shall be punished by imprisonment for a period not exceeding three months or by a fine not exceeding four thousand dirhams and the court may order his deportation.
